Accounts With A Products!
Note Subject Correction: - Accounts Without A Product.
Hi friends,
I want to know how you handle accounts in your system that h as no products or services.
The example of this is, a client whose hosting account or domain has expired.
Do you keep the account active, cancel or deleted?
Also, give reasons for why?
Thank you.

We keep them as records, these also come down to sales/invoices so that we can show that to the ATO (Australian Taxation Office) if we were ever audited. Other people may take their own actions to this, but under Australian law we must keep information regarding sales/transactions for up to 5 years.

I think when it comes down to it, why do you want to delete the accounts? Are they using any resources that you could use elsewhere? If the only resource is a record in your database, I would leave it active. If nothing else, the account is already there for them to signup again in the future if they want.
If there are resources used that you want to recover, delete it.

Im using ClientExec,
& im running Pending accounts deletion that deletes pending new accounts with unpaid invoices after 7 Days,
Once Product's Invoice is paid and client' account turned to active, I m keeping their active account wether cancelled, suspended, or didnt renew,
Reason, is that keeping their login info active simply tells the customer that we welcome you anytime you decided to come back using our services, even if he wouldnt think of reusing us again, but the feedback & Impression
